'i n its Mrs. Elizabeth H. Wray, Secre- tary. Right: David Leeds, Bill Oben- our, Flora Schoolfield, Priscilla Darris, and Sara Alford ask Mrs. Wray for a pass to class. Below: Mrs. Wray handles much of the school's business over the telephone. i .. I ....-. MRS. WRAY Without Mrs. Wray life at West High School wouldn't be the same. With her friendly smile, kind words, and sweet disposition she is indispensible. One of her most remarkable qualities is that she knows the name of every student almost as soon as he ar- rives. No hour of the day finds Mrs. Wray too busy to listen to any problem a student may have- whether it concerns problems at school, problems at home, or the problem of a broken romance. With her unselfish attitude and her willingness to help, she has been a wonderful inspiration to all who at- tend West High. - M . ,I 21

Mr. R. E. C. Love, Principal. Mr. Love has been the principal of West High School for the seven years of its existence. With the faculty he develops a fuller and more satisfactory curriculum to the advantage of the students. Mr. Love has been more to the student body than a dis- ciplinarian. His high standards have been a guiding influence to the students, and his sympathetic under- standing of their viewpoints and problems has made him greatly respected. Changing schedules to meet the needs of stu- dents, being sure that the business of the school is properly transacted, and attending all school func- tions are but a few of Mr. Love's many duties. est. N . MR. LOVE Above: Mr. Love uses the phone, which is a necessity in his work, to discuss business. Left: Mr. Love counsels Marilyn Frost, David Leeds, and Suz- anne Bell in one of the various school projects.

FACULTY Mrs. Lenore Beverly Bowling Green Business Universityg M.S., University of Tennessee. She teaches distributive education. Miss Lucile Evans B.A., University of Tennesseeg M.A., Columbia University. She teaches Latin and Algebra. Mr. Walter Ganz B.S., Lockhaven State Teachers Collegeg New York University: M.A., University of Tennessee. He teaches biology and general science and is also coach. Mr. James T. Hardin B.S., Carson-Newman College. He teaches chemistry and physics. Mrs. Naomi Hina BA., Maryville Collegeg M.A., University of Tennessee. She teaches English and journal- ism.
